Idris Elba is still in the frame to become the next James Bond.<br /><br /><br /><br />The London-born actor has been persistently linked with the coveted role over recent years and movie boss Barbara Broccoli has reportedly told an industry pal "it is time" for a non-white star to play 007.<br /><br /><br /><br />Director Antoine Fuqua said Barbara feels the moment has arrived for an ethnic minority actor to play Bond, adding that it will "happen eventually".<br /><br /><br /><br />He said, according to the Daily Star newspaper: "Idris could do it if he was in shape. You need a guy with physically strong presence. Idris has that."<br /><br /><br /><br />Idris is one of a number of big-name stars to have been linked with replacing Daniel Craig as Bond.<br /><br />
